Software Description

TransDecoder is software for identifying candidate coding regions within transcript sequences, including those from de novo RNA-Seq transcript assembly via Trinity, or from RNA-Seq alignments to the genome using Tophat and Cufflinks.

General Linux

To load this module for use in a Linux environment, you can run the command:

module load transdecoder

Depending on where you are working, there may be more than one version of transdecoder available. To see which modules are available for loading you can run:

module avail transdecoder
